Psicología del color
Dark blues like navy and midnight convey authority, intelligence, and unshakeable confidence. They are the color of police uniforms, corporate suits, and official documents worldwide. Navy blue inspires feelings of security and order, anchoring visual hierarchies with gravitas.
Design Usage
Dark blue is the premier choice for header backgrounds, navigation bars, and footer sections in corporate websites. It provides excellent contrast for white text and creates a sense of depth and professionalism. Pair it with bright accent colors like orange or lime for vibrant CTAs that pop against the authoritative background.
